Chapter 38 Summary

Gram is excited that the kiss finally happened. Sal doesn't dare to check their progress on the map. She feels that they may have a chance if she keeps talking and praying underneath. Gram asks what happens next with Phoebe.

Sal finds Phoebe at the bus stop, sitting on the bench. When Phoebe asks where she's been, Sal's evasive. She wants to tell her about Ben and his mother but can't. Phoebe watched them sit there, having a great time. Her mother's hair is short now. She even spits on the grass in the middle of her conversation. Mike Bickle laughs and follows her suit.
